Job Summary

Personnel member who supports the school in building the internal capacity to implement and sustain MTSS practices including behavior and academic interventions and coordinates the Roxboro Community School (RCS) 504 EL and AIG programs. The Coordinator works with all staff to provide support for special populations of students to realize their full potential.

Essential Job Functions:

The Coordinator will:

  • Continue to monitor and refine MTSS practices to ensure alignment with best practices student needs state law and federal requirements.
  • Support MTSS implementation by working with RCSs Academic Coach to provide evidence-based professional development.
  • Meet with School Leadership Teams to assess needs and identify goals for MTSS implementation.
  • Support the collection and analysis of implementation data to ensure high fidelity in the implementation of MTSS activities/plans.
  • Support the creation of social-emotional and behavioral components and other related services within the MTSS model.
  • Provide reports to stakeholders.
  • Assist with developing and maintaining eligibility criteria for enrichment and intervention services.
  • Collaborate with staff to ensure support at the general education and special education levels.
  • Assist with integrating initiatives/services in MTSS problem-solving best practices.
  • Work with and meet regularly with staff to support them in providing direct services to eligible students.
  • Provide input toward the building of the master schedule.
  • Provide 504 compliance monitoring to ensure the School complies with federal and state laws including maintaining up-to-date policies non-discrimination statements and accessible facilities.
  • Provide 504 case management by overseeing the referral evaluation and reevaluation process for students to determine eligibility.
  • Support teams in developing implementing and monitoring 504 plans for students.
  • Train staff on 504 regulations responsibilities and disability awareness.
  • Serve as the primary point of contact for parents staff and the Office for Civil Rights (OCR) regarding 504 concerns.
  • Grievance Resolution: Investigate complaints regarding discrimination disability harassment or violations of Section 504/ADA.
  • Support the 6th and 9th grades with administrative-related responsibilities including but not limited to academic support behavior support and grade span transition.
  • Maintain and update AIG and EL plans as required by NC DPI. Create annual student AIG/EL student plans. Screen and identify potential AIG/EL students at the beginning of each academic year.

Qualifications:

  • Strong understanding of and experience with MTSS basic principles and components
  • Strong understanding of and experience supporting advanced learners and students with intervention needs.
  • Strong understanding of student assessment methods data collection and data analysis
  • Strong communication skills
  • Strong collaboration and interpersonal skills
  • Knowledge of the Early Warning System in Infinite Campus
